assert_error4.phpt 488 B

123456789101112131415161718192021
  1. --TEST--
  2. assert() - basic - Test recoverable error
  3. --INI--
  4. assert.active = 1
  5. assert.warning = 1
  6. assert.callback = f1
  7. assert.quiet_eval = 0
  8. assert.bail = 0
  9. error_reporting = -1
  10. display_errors = 1
  11. --FILE--
  12. <?php
  13. $sa = "0 $ 0";
  14. var_dump($r2 = assert($sa, "Describing what was asserted"));
  15. --EXPECTF--
  16. Parse error: syntax error, unexpected '$' in %s(3) : assert code on line 1
  17. Catchable fatal error: assert(): Failure evaluating code:
  18. Describing what was asserted:"0 $ 0" in %s on line 3